This is a suit for refund of estate taxes erroneously assessed and paid brought in this court under 28 U.S.C. § 1346(a)(1). Plaintiffs are the executors of the estate of decedent who died in 1971. It is the government's inclusion of the assets of an inter vivos irrevocable trust in the decedent's taxable estate that gives rise to the present claim.
